MINUTES — Management Meeting, Product-Line Retirement

Attendees: sales leads, product, operations. Decision confirmed: the Bramleigh Series will be retired at end of fiscal year. Remaining stock will be sold at current pricing; no clearance discounting before the final quarter. Support obligations continue for eighteen months. Sales leads should begin migrating accounts to the Ferrow line and report objections weekly. Customer messaging is not yet approved. The rationale for the timing is captured in the confidential note below.

internal memo for kagap-hahop: The western region missed its Sorix quota by 35.5 percent last quarter. Pelmirix Logistics plans to lower the Gormir list price by 59.4 percent in March. The steering committee signed off on a budget of $26.9 million for Project Eliok. The renewal with Tamaxek Works closes at $158.0 million a year, 45.5 percent above the last contract.

### Runbook — Matchline GC pauses

If matcher p99 spikes, check GC pause logs first. Pauses over 400ms trigger the shed valve; don't restart blindly. Mitigation: deploy the tuned-heap build from the hotfix channel. That build must be signed or the rollout agent rejects it. Verify checksum, then sign with the emergency deploy key:

deploy key for yajop-fahop: bky3_h1v

The Quillbrook solver now uses simulated annealing for the secondary-school pilot at Ferndale Academy. Hard constraints (room capacity, teacher availability) are enforced at generation time; soft constraints (gap minimization, subject spacing) are scored in the objective function. Runtime on the full Ferndale dataset dropped from eleven minutes to under four after we capped restart attempts. Mira from the scheduling team will profile the cooling schedule next sprint. The current annealing parameters we're running in staging are listed here.

tuning table, yajog-yahof:
BUDGETS = {
    "lamvan": 303,
    "wenox": 460,
    "fenvan": 525,
}

Handover Note — Warranty Costs, Dravern Appliances

To my successor: the Calyx dryer line has run 38% over warranty budget for two consecutive quarters, driven by a drum-bearing defect in units built at the Norwick plant. A supplier claim is in progress and a design fix ships next month. Reserve adequacy needs your early attention. The board's intended response is noted confidentially below.

confidential, kahog-tahag: The renewal with Holixax Holdings closes at $5 million a year, 20 percent below the last contract. Project Ulaael slips by one quarter because of the supplier delay.